Program Overview
This postgraduate-level short course, Advanced Intellectual Property Law, offers you the opportunity to develop a critical analysis of key legal debates and gain an insight into contemporary issues in this area. It will introduce you to the international and historical aspects of intellectual property law. You will also analyse the theoretical justifications for intellectual property law and examine the consequences of the commodification of knowledge. You will develop a critical understanding of intellectual property law and consider alternative intellectual property practices.
This course is ideal if you have a professional or personal interest in the field of law. You will also find it of particular interest if you wish to enhance your career through Continuing Professional Development in this area.
This short course is assessed by a 4000-word essay.
30 credits at level 7
